The late 20th century brought seismic shifts, driven by feminist movements and changing social mores. Characters like Mary Tyler Moore’s Mary Richards—a single, career-focused woman "who could turn the world on with her smile"—offered a new blueprint. This era saw the rise of action heroines (Sigourney Weaver’s Ripley in Alien ), complex anti-heroes, and women who prioritized ambition over romance. Yet, this progress was often double-edged. The 1990s and 2000s introduced the "post-feminist" heroine, who was ostensibly empowered but still obsessed with shopping, weight, and finding a husband, as seen in shows like Sex and the City and Ally McBeal .
